Kickboxing Federation Suspends Three States
The Kickboxing Federation of Nigeria (KBFN) yesterday announced the suspension of Lagos, Benue and Edo States for two years to enforce discipline in the sport.
The three states were suspended after they were found guilty of causing mayhem during the 18th National Sports Festival in Lagos (Eko 2012).
Kickboxing was the only sport that was not concluded at the festival, following what the three states claimed as ‘unfair officiating’ during a match, resulting in a fracas.
Bisi Odubote, the KBFN’s Secretary, told Tidesports that suspension letters had been sent to the affected states, noting that the action was based on findings by the jury the Federation set up to look into the matter.
“What happened at the festival in kickboxing was unpleasant; there was a protest panel on ground to complain to but the states did not follow due process, which is unacceptable,’’ Odubote said.
Wilson Okon, a member of the technical board of the federation, also told Tidesports that the suspension would serve as lesson to other states in subsequent festivals and other national competitions.
Okon said that such disruptive approach was not good for the development of the sport, stressing that as a growing sport in the country, it needed disciplined players and officials to develop.
“This is a developing sport, and both the athletes and officials must be made to exhibit all forms of discipline in their approach, no matter the situation,’’ he said.
According to him, kickboxing has 34 contestable events in a competition, and therefore, requires a minimum of eight days to complete, including some days for players and officials to rest.
